I'll ping you the link offline. > Alex > > On Mon, Aug 10, 2026 at 10:35 AM Mario Limonciello <[email protected]> wrote: >> >> On 8/8/26 07:09, Guangshuo Li wrote: >>> amdgpu_pci_probe() calls pm_runtime_use_autosuspend(), but >>> amdgpu_pci_remove() does not call the matching >>> pm_runtime_dont_use_autosuspend(). >>> >>> If the autosuspend delay is set to a negative value while autosuspend >>> is enabled, the runtime PM core increments usage_count to prevent >>> runtime suspend. Without calling pm_runtime_dont_use_autosuspend() >>> during teardown, this reference is not dropped and usage_count remains >>> unbalanced. >>> >>> The documentation for pm_runtime_use_autosuspend() also notes that it >>> is important to undo it with pm_runtime_dont_use_autosuspend() at >>> driver exit time, unless runtime PM was initially enabled with >>> devm_pm_runtime_enable(). >>> >>> Add the missing pm_runtime_dont_use_autosuspend() call to the remove >>> path. >>> >>> This issue was found by manual code inspection. >>> >>> Fixes: d38ceaf99ed0 ("drm/amdgpu: add core driver (v4)") >>> Cc: [email protected] >>> Signed-off-by: Guangshuo Li <[email protected]> >> >> Reviewed-by: Mario Limonciello (AMD) <[email protected]> >> >> Also applied to amd-staging-drm-next. >> >>> --- >>> dr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_drv.c | 1 + >>>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+) >>> >>> di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_drv.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_drv.c >>> index 1aed121f4ddb..e814701bc8fd 100644 >>> --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_drv.c >>> +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_drv.c >>> @@ -2548,6 +2548,7 @@ amdgpu_pci_remove(struct pci_dev *pdev) >>> if (adev->pm.rpm_mode != AMDGPU_RUNPM_NONE) { >>> pm_runtime_get_sync(dev->dev); >>> pm_runtime_forbid(dev->dev); >>> + pm_runtime_dont_use_autosuspend(dev->dev); >>> } >>> >>> amdgpu_driver_unload_kms(dev); >>
